Tanglewood Adds to Popular Artists Series
Tanglewood has announced two new additions to this summer's Popular Artists Series.
Liza Minelli will perform in the Shed on Monday, August 17. Bonnie Raitt, with special
acoustic performance by Jackson Browne, will be at Tanglewood on Monday, August 24.

Located in Lenox, Massachusetts, Tanglewood is the summer performance home of the Boston
Symphony Orchestra and hosts a variety of other musical events throughout the summer.

Grandma Moses Mystery Solved
The Wall Street Journal reported May 8 that seven paintings by renowned artist Anna Mary Robertson Moses (1860-1961), better known as Grandma Moses, have mysteriously reappeared after a 14-year absence. The paintings were bequeathed to the Bennington Museum in Bennington, Vermont, by the late Margaret Carr of Pennsylvania, but mysteriously vanished from her home and were never turned over to the musuem. On February 9, they were anonymously returned to the museum, which now has them on display with its existing Grandma Moses collection--the largest public display of the artist's works. While you're at the museum, you can also visit the one-room 1834 schoolhouse Grandma Moses and other members of her family attended in nearby Eagle Bridge, New York; it was moved to the Bennington Museum's grounds in 1972. Grandma Moses' life and achievements are captured in an exhibit at the schoolhouse.
